It would seem that the wages of leading sports men are insanely high but I was reading a study recently about UK soccer players and it seems that over 75% of them are bankrupt within 5 years of retirement.  The study theorised that getting vast amounts of money with no real struggle meant that the players never really learned the value of their money or how to budget it.

The big winners from high pay for soccer stars are (apparently) the owners of sports car dealerships...
